iStore Phone Repair
About the Business
iStore Phone Repair deals with a cracked screen, cell phones repairs near me, cheap cell phone screen repair and crack screen repair cost. The business is located at 85 Western Ave, South Portland (ME 04106). You can find more details about iStore Phone Repair location on the map. The GPS coordinates are: 43.6351539, -70.3174075. It was founded in 2011 and Mobile Phone Repairs in South Portland maker the core business of this company. The payment method they accept is cash, credit cards. Being located in United States, they accept USD as the payment currency. You can quickly call iStore Phone Repair via phone number 1-207-613-9163, and you can send an e-mail or visit their website for more information.